According to AppleInsider, Taiwan-based Foxconn Electronics has received an initial build order -- from Apple -- for 12-million phone units. Other details have not yet been released.
"The design will be an iPod nano-like candy bar form factor and come in three colors (we are not certain of the exact colors but we suspect black, white and platinum, similar to Apple's current color scheme of iPods and Macs)," he wrote in a note to clients. Analysts at Prudential have also weighed in with their findings on the iPod cell phone initiative, stating in an October report that Apple would initially produce two models -- one being a smart phone, which would include an integrated keyboard, video and music capability, while the other model would be slimmer with only music functionality
